Barça management are "losing Dembélé by themselves" - agent

Dembélé's agent discussed the player's contract situation amid reports that Barcelona have threatened to leave him out of the team for the rest of the season.

Talks over a new Ousmane Dembélé deal at Barcelona are still ongoing and it remains to be sign if the winger will leave Camp Nou this month.

Catalan daily Sport have reported that Dembélé met with Barcelona manager Xavi earlier on Tuesday to tell him that he wants to stay at the club and sign a new deal beyond his current one, which expires on 30 June 2022. Just hours later, his agent, Moussa Sissoko, spoke to French outlet RMC Sport, and explained his feelings towards the lengthy contract talks.

Barça putting the pressure on

"They’re putting the pressure on, but it doesn’t work with people like us. Maybe it works with agents who are close to Barcelona. That’s not the case with me, I’m here to defend my player’s interests," Sissoko said.

"We are not here to fuel debates on social media. We have tough demands, but we have already shown that Ousmane's career was not dictated by money, otherwise, he wouldn't be here. If Barcelona wanted to negotiate, they could have come to the table with us to talk. Except there are no discussions and there are threats coming from them that he won’t play. That’s not allowed. We will exercise Ousmane Dembélé’s rights if necessary."

"We don’t know what we’re going to do, nothing has been agreed or signed but the management are losing Ousmane by themselves. From the start, we’ve shown that we wanted to negotiate, with terms, but without closing the door," he added.

European clubs linked with winger

Barça have also reportedly been open to listening to offers for the France international as they fear losing him for free this summer. Newcastle United, Manchester United and Bayern Munich have all been linked with Dembélé.
